- Abstract: In this study, bamboo fiber filled polypropylene composites (BPCs) were prepared using bamboo and coconut shell charcoal as reinforcing fillers for enhancing the properties of composites. Bamboo and coconut shell biomass were carbonized at different carbonization temperatures (300, 400, 600, and 900 O C); 1 h soaking time and at 5 O C −min heating rates. The effect of carbonization temperature and charcoal content (0.5%, 1.0% and 1.5%) on mechanical, thermal and water absorption properties of BPCs has been investigated. The experimental results show that charcoal which is obtained at lower pyrolysis temperature (300 O C and 400 O C) improves the strength properties of BPCs, whereas, strength properties remains unaltered when charcoal prepared at elevated temperatures (600 O C and 900 O C) are added to BPCs. Compared to coconut shell charcoal (CSC) better mechanical properties were obtained through bamboo charcoal (BC). This has been attributed to flakes like appearance of BC, having pores present on their surfaces. The study also shows that addition of charcoal provides thermal stability to BPCs, particularly via charcoal prepared at elevated temperature (900 O C). The optimum temperature for achieving sufficient hydrophobicity in BPCs is found to be 300 O C and 600 O C for BC and CSC, respectively.
